Eps. 116 - Second Hand Screaming

On this week’s podcast the 3 Amigo’s are back together again and they’re talking about giving. Is it hard for you to give ? Do you believe that if you give it will be given back to you ? CJ poses the question to ET in regards to how it’s so easy for him to give without thinking twice about it. The answer to his question isn’t based on the amount of money in your bank account it’s a mindset and the guys are going to teach you how to get a giver’s mindset.

In this episode of the "Secret to Success" podcast, CJ hosts an engaging conversation featuring co-host Karl Wesley Phillips, Dr. King, ET and special guest Gersh King. The episode kicks off with the hosts catching up, sharing a light-hearted and humorous dialogue that sets the tone for an inspiring discussion. Gersh King, a physical therapist known for his exceptional skills and dedication, shares his journey of personal and professional growth. He discusses his experiences with challenges such as homelessness, ADHD, and anxiety, and how he overcame them through intense dedication to his craft and personal development. Gersh emphasizes the importance of impact over monetary gain, explaining how he discovered fulfillment through service and honing his skills. He also delves into his rigorous routine, including his practice of lunges and a disciplined workout regimen inspired by figures like Bruce Lee. The hosts touch on topics like the power of breathing techniques to manage anxiety and enhance focus. Gersh leads a brief breathing exercise to demonstrate how proper breathing can ground you and activate the parasympathetic system for relaxation. The conversation further explores philosophies from Bruce Lee, the significance of being authentic, and how to harness one's energy and skills to become a master in their field. This episode is a deep dive into the mindset and practices required to achieve personal and professional mastery, offering listeners practical tips and inspiration to pursue their own paths to success.
